    About Mike-William

    Mike-William Assisted Living Facility, sometimes called Mike-William ALF, sits at 6313 Joyce Dr in Temple Hills and also at 7404 Ben Drive in Oxon Hill, Maryland, and they've got another name they use too: Oxon-Hi. Both locations serve seniors with a simple ranch-style home layout, no stairs, and private cozy rooms with inviting common areas that help folks feel relaxed and comfortable whether they're spending time alone or socializing. The home's got walking trails through wooded parks nearby and it's close to golf courses, so residents who like fresh air or watching wildlife have nice outdoor options. The environment stays clean, safe, and quiet, with the usual care you'd expect from a board and care home, and both men and women can live there but only accepts one at a time.

    Owned and run by a registered nurse, Mike-William has caregivers who got vetted thoroughly and seem to know how to handle all sorts of care needs, whether someone needs regular assisted living, skilled nursing, home health care, hospice care, memory care, or even just a little help now and then through respite and adult day services. They've got a solid high staff-to-resident ratio, 24-hour supervision, nurses always on-call, and doctors who visit. Seniors getting care here can count on medication management, help with daily living like bathing or meals, and specialized services for folks facing Alzheimer's or high-acuity medical needs. There's an in-house pharmacy, labs, x-rays, and regular visits from podiatrists and therapists for folks' health. Someone who needs a dentist or physical, occupational, or speech therapy can get those arranged right there.

    Everyone gets encouragement to join activities like fitness classes, bingo, small group games, or social events right on site, and if someone wants worship or spiritual activities there are devotional services available outside the facility. Meals are prepared for everyone, and there's resident parking plus wheelchair accessible showers. Residents can bring their pets if they have any, get their hair done with available beauty and barber services, and folks use indoor and outdoor common spaces for chatting or relaxing. The place has smoke-free policies and tries hard to keep everything tidy and peaceful.

    Seniors get a choice here-short-term stays, long-term living, independent living, or more focused help like memory care or skilled nursing-so if someone needs to move in for recovery or just wants to try the place out before deciding, respite care works for that. Folks from Maryland, Virginia, and the Washington DC area can move in, and most families say the sense of community is strong, with people looking out for each other. Mike-William has even received awards like "Best of Senior Living 2025," which shows some outside folks have noticed their work. The goal here seems to be simple: help each resident feel secure, comfortable, and as independent as possible, giving them proper care and real companionship along the way.
